- [ ] **Step 7: Breaker override escrow.** After sealing the signing keys for the Tallgrove upstream API circuit breaker, confirm the support team can force the breaker open during a full outage. The override bundle lives in the sealed escrow drawer and is useless without its unlock phrase. Two ceremony witnesses must initial this step before proceeding. The escrow bundle is decrypted with the recovery passphrase that follows.

vault phrase of kahip-kahop = holath-quenmir

**Mgmt Meeting Minutes — Retiring the Brightline Range**

Quick recap for sales leads at Fenholt Supplies: we agreed to retire the Brightline fixture range by year-end. Remaining stock moves to clearance pricing next month, and accounts on standing orders get migrated to the Lumetta range. Trade-in incentives were approved in principle. The confidential note on next steps sits just below.

board note of bajof-bajeg: The pricing group signed off on a budget of $13.4 million for Project Sildor. The renewal with Lamixek Holdings closes at $48.9 million a year, 49 percent above the last contract.

## Environment Variables — Relevance Tuning (Querymill)

The ranking weights for the Querymill search service are controlled via env vars rather than the config map, so reviewers should check both. RANK_TITLE_BOOST defaults to 2.4 and RANK_RECENCY_DECAY to 0.08; the staging overrides were tuned after the Brellford catalog import skewed results toward archived items. Changes to these values require a reindex. The tuning service also authenticates against the metrics collector, so the env file must set its token on the next line.

vault entry, yajop-bafop: ARCHIVE_KEY3=8d4

Subject: Waveform preview cut-over — done

Hey Mira,

Quick recap for your review: we flipped audio waveform previews on SoundLoft from the legacy renderer to the new Ripplecast service last night. No auth changes, same signed-URL flow, and the old endpoint is now read-only until Friday. Latency looks fine. For your sign-off checklist, the current service configuration is below.

deployment values, bagag-bawig:
DRUVAN_PIN=0740
DRUVAN_TENANT=wendor
DRUVAN_METRICS_HOST=metrics.druvan.tolvaqnet.example
DRUVAN_SEAL=seal_75cd0b2d
DRUVAN_STANDBY_TEAM=tamael